Biglaw Firm Raises Associate Salaries in Anticipation of Merger

Shearman & Sterling, which is set to merge with Allen & Overy next year, has announced associate raises effective January 1. The new salary scale will match the top of Biglaw, with annual salaries ranging from $225,000 for the Class of 2023 to $435,000 for the Class of 2016+. Bonuses will also be provided, ranging from $15,000 to $115,000, with the possibility of enhanced bonuses for exceptional performance. The merger will create A&O Shearman, the third largest law firm in the world.

Biglaw Firms Rush to Match Associate Pay Raises

Willkie Farr & Gallagher, a top 50 Biglaw firm, has announced associate raises and bonuses. The new compensation grid includes salary increases ranging from $225,000 to $435,000, depending on the associate's class year. Cravath Surpasses Milbank Scale with Associate Raises

Cravath has announced raises for its associates, matching the scale set by Milbank for junior associates and surpassing it for midlevel and senior associates. The new salary scale will take effect on January 1, with raises ranging from $5,000 to $20,000. Cravath has also announced year-end bonuses that match Milbank's numbers. As a leader in compensation, Cravath's move is expected to prompt other Biglaw firms to react.
